ZIP code 58438 covers Fessenden, North Dakota, with a population of about 688 and a median household income of $66,172.

Where 58438 is

Fessenden, North Dakota — the area the Census Bureau draws for this ZIP code. ZIP codes are sets of delivery routes rather than areas, so this is the Census approximation of one, not a Postal Service boundary.
